Форум OperaFan
04-07-2009, 03:40 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.

Войти
Совет: Никогда не отклоняйтесь от изначальной темы. Если чуствуете что вам есть что сказать по другому вопросу, пусть и косвенно связанному с этой -- пишите в другой теме, сделав отсылку на первоначальную тему, если это уместно. Если вопрос не связан -- тем более пишите в другую тему.
Страниц: [1] 2 3 ... 29
  Печать  
Автор OBook Plugin
Dmitry Antonyuk
Разработчик

Сообщений: 97


Просмотр профиля
13-02-2006, 17:01

Obook Plugin 1.0 Release

Что нового:
Удалось отказаться от постоянно загруженного в память OBint.exe
+ добавлен диалог "Сохранить как..."
+ настраиваемый поиск по дате, заголовку и url
+ сортировка папок по дате сохранения
+ F3 для активации поиска
+ формат obook.xml переведен в UTF-8
+ сохранение в выбранную папку обука
+ меню Опции
+ сохранение ссылок на локальные файлы
+ двойной клик в пустом месте obook создает новую папку
+ параметр Editor в obook.ini
+ новый диалог интеграции кнопок в Оперу

Известные проблемы с Opera 8.x
Выбор мышью пунктов из выпадающего списка поиска
Передача клавиатурного фокуса в поле поиска

Известные проблемы с Opera 8.x - 9.x
При загрузке одного obook.xml в несколько окон Оперы  после переключения окна необходимо нажать Reload(Обновить) для обновления данных obook.xml - в противном случае возможна потеря изменений сделанных в предыдущем окне.

Спасибо  Вам за тестирование и предложения!

Особо хочу поблагодарить  Mongoose  - Kildor  - Dennis Hawks  и profiT

Скриншот
Скачать - (970Kb)
« Последнее редактирование: 16-07-2006, 20:38 от Dmitry Antonyuk » Записан
Kildor
OperaFan Team

Версия Opera: 9.02:8585
Сообщений: 941

Homo virtualis


Просмотр профиля
13-02-2006, 19:29

а если не секрет, почему такое ограничение на девятку?
Дополнено : 13-02-2006, 20:28
PS: может куда-нить помимо народа выложить? Ибо совсем тяжко тянуть оттуда
Записан

Да, я гик!!
«…Мой ангел не спит, он скорей всего пьян…
кто знает, чья вечность беспечней, чья призрачней истина.
чьи души вселяются в чаек, чьи в рыб и медуз…»
Dmitry Antonyuk
Разработчик

Сообщений: 97


Просмотр профиля
13-02-2006, 19:45


а если не секрет, почему такое ограничение на девятку?
- конечно нет, в 9ке же не работает "Save document with images as"
По поводу народа пока не знаю.... посмотрю что нибудь.....
Записан
Kildor
OperaFan Team

Версия Opera: 9.02:8585
Сообщений: 941

Homo virtualis


Просмотр профиля
13-02-2006, 20:30

Всё, понял… ;-)
Записан

Да, я гик!!
«…Мой ангел не спит, он скорей всего пьян…
кто знает, чья вечность беспечней, чья призрачней истина.
чьи души вселяются в чаек, чьи в рыб и медуз…»
ELV1S
OperaFan Team

Сообщений: 1 400



Просмотр профиля WWW
13-02-2006, 21:04

Dmitry Antonyuk
При установке на Opera 8.51, кнопки на тулбар добавились в Opera 9!
Подскажите, что этот OBook Plugin ещё мне в девятой опере добавил в меню или тулбар.
« Последнее редактирование: 27-09-2006, 23:53 от Mongoose » Записан

Не пишите мне личные сообщения. Спрашивайте на форуме.
Dimanish
Профи

Сообщений: 336


Просмотр профиля
13-02-2006, 21:33

Dmitry Antonyuk
Очень рад появлению еще одной программы для сохранения страниц Оперой.
Возникло несколько вопросов:
1. Перед сохранением при помощи пункта меню, кнопки на тулбаре и т.п. необходимо вручную запускать некий OBInt.exe?
Стоит заметить - не очень удобно...
2. Проверил - программа сохраняет страницы в папки, у которых в качестве имени выступает дата сохранения (а-ля Scrapbook).
Потом же совсем не удобно просматривать сохраненные страницы - нет title, где какая страница сохранена, не понятно.
Должна быть какая-то боковая панель?
Записан
Dimanish
Профи

Сообщений: 336


Просмотр профиля
13-02-2006, 21:35

А, да. При сохранении Опера периодически вылетает.
Записан
GeoD
Любитель

Версия Opera: Opera 9.63 (10476), Opera Mini 4.2.0, Opera 10 alpha
Сообщений: 194



Просмотр профиля
13-02-2006, 21:39

У меня папки создает, но страницы туда не сохраняет. Установил повторно - Opera при сохранении стала зависать.
Записан
Dmitry Antonyuk
Разработчик

Сообщений: 97


Просмотр профиля
14-02-2006, 06:53

Опишу подробно процесс установки:
1. Инсталлятор берет из реестра ключ  HKLU…Opera software… Last CommandLine v2   (путь до  последней запущенной Оперы), извлекает имя папки и ищет эту папку в пользовательском профиле.
2. В профиле в файле opera6.ini получаем имена файлов меню и панелей, и в них прописываем запуск Launcher.exe,  в opera6.adr прописываем закладку на Bookmark.htm для отображения на панели справа, там же (в профиле) создаем obook.ini и в него прописываем путь до хранилища.

Установка файлов:

Эти файлы ставятся в c:\Program Files\Obook Plugin\

Launcher.exe – Запускает процесс сохранения в Obook.
OBhook.dll –hook для перехвата диалога сохранения.
OBInt.exe – Непосредственно запускает hook – должен запускаться при старте системы.
Bookmark.htm – Добавляет закладку на панель слева.

License.txt – понятно
obook.ico - понятно
unins000.dat – деинсталлятор
unins000.exe – деинсталлятор

В папку Oперы в  c:\Program Files\Opera\program\plugins\
Ставится obook.dll – отвечает за отображение панели слева.

Во время установки у пользователя запрашивается:
1.   автоматически определенный каталог Оперы.
2.   каталог в котором будет хранится база.
3.   каталог для файлов Obook Plugin

Программа тестировалась на 5 компьютерах, ни одной из перечисленных  ошибок не было....
ингода, не переодически при завершении какой либо программы появлялось сообщение об ошибке, но и то очень редко.

Для чистой проверки работы необходимо, закрыть все Оперы, запустить OBInt.exe - появится иконка возле часов, запустить 8 или 8.5
« Последнее редактирование: 14-02-2006, 09:01 от Dmitry Antonyuk » Записан
Dmitry Antonyuk
Разработчик

Сообщений: 97


Просмотр профиля
14-02-2006, 08:06

Цитировать

При установке на Opera 8.51, кнопки на тулбар добавились в Opera 9!

Может все таки что то с профилем Оперы? девятка встала поверх 8, а восьмерка тоже работает с тем же профилем?

Цитировать

1. Перед сохранением при помощи пункта меню, кнопки на тулбаре и т.п. необходимо вручную запускать некий OBInt.exe?

OBInt.exe должен запустится после установки, если включена галочка в Setup и висеть в трее.

Цитировать

Должна быть какая-то боковая панель?

Так она и добавляется, красно белая иконка на панели слева, где закладки, история и прочие
Записан
Dimanish
Профи

Сообщений: 336


Просмотр профиля
14-02-2006, 08:42

Странно, все кнопки появляются.
Сохраняю страницу, проверяю - страница сохранена на диске, открываю боковую панель - пусто.
Записан
Dmitry Antonyuk
Разработчик

Сообщений: 97


Просмотр профиля
14-02-2006, 08:50

Кстати а SaveAsIE используется?
Верхнюю панель инструментов видно, как на скриншоте с 5ю кнопками?
Идет ли запись в файл \Папка базы\Data\obook.xml?
Можно попробывать вручную открыть c:\Program Files\Obook Plugin\Bookmark.htm если плагин установлен то должен появится список сохраненных станичек.
Записан
Dimanish
Профи

Сообщений: 336


Просмотр профиля
14-02-2006, 08:59

SaveAsIE не используется.
Верхней панели нет.
Запись в obook.xml не идет. Может конфликт с page2chm?
Записан
GeoD
Любитель

Версия Opera: Opera 9.63 (10476), Opera Mini 4.2.0, Opera 10 alpha
Сообщений: 194



Просмотр профиля
14-02-2006, 09:04

Цитировать
открываю боковую панель - пусто.
У меня вчера была та же история, но оказалось, что установка прошла криво (вчера было 13 число Улыбаюсь ). Оказалось, что
Цитировать
папки создает, но страницы туда не сохраняет

Сегодня я удалил программу, вычистил реестр от остатков созданных ею ключей и установил заново. И в результате все работает нормально.
Почти... Улыбаюсь
А именно, при сохранении возникает окно типа "не могу найти файл index.htm", но страница сохраняется и в панели появляется.

Я должен все же поблагодарить разработчика. Я давно скучал по аналогу Файрфоксовского Scrapbook для Opera и писал об этом в одном из пожеланий. И вот теперь мы имеем это!  Смеюсь
« Последнее редактирование: 14-02-2006, 09:20 от GeoD » Записан
Dmitry Antonyuk
Разработчик

Сообщений: 97


Просмотр профиля
14-02-2006, 09:15

Dimanish
по команде opera:plugins должна появится следующая строка
application/obook-plugin   obk   
C:\Program Files\Opera\Program\Plugins\obook.dll
попробывать поискать obook.dll  в папке 9ки
с page2chm - конфликтовать не должен из-за принципа.

GeoD[\b] - Спасибо!
Записан
Страниц: [1] 2 3 ... 29
  Печать  
 
Перейти в:  

OperaFan © 2006-2009, OperaFan Team
Powered by SMF 1.1.9 | SMF © 2006, Simple Machines LLC | Sitemap